




Flagstaff Hunter Knife - 5 inch In Walnut
Crafted using CNC milling, allowing for blade geometries
that are impossible via conventional blade manufacture. Each blade small batch hardened (no more than
a dozen at a time) to ensure an optimal hardness of 60HRC. The blades are made from Takefu 67-layer San
Mai, with a VG10 core. VG10 is arguably one of Japan's finest stainless knife
steels. Each blade is individually
etched in a mixture of hydrochloric acid and ferric chloride before being
cleaned and buffed. The blade geometry
allows for a substantial and rigid spine, with a concave blade profile leading
to a razor-sharp cutting edge. The
handles are created from authentic Purdey gunstock walnut, that has been
pressure-reinforced with an epoxide polymer.
The strip of Audley red that sets the handles apart consists of
layered glass fibre. Each handle is
shaped, sanded, oiled and finished by hand.
The handle is secured using a combination of marine epoxy and custom
rivets applied with a 2-tonne press. The
sheaths are made in Devon from oak-tanned leather.
